Output 510977aee4f8da643fb18ebb36f41692cfcb9aebbc912c72887260a018d7cc90:0

value
1025246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bab4dea57419d844563c12ee4420b9f72e245b32 OP_EQUALVERIFY OP_CHECKSIG
address
1J2DMjFEzAsEWrNeZ3UnMv4esFRU2ZNG92
transaction
510977aee4f8da643fb18ebb36f41692cfcb9aebbc912c72887260a018d7cc90
spent
true